What is a Business Analyst at DISH?
The Business Analyst role at DISH is pivotal in bridging the gap between business needs and technology solutions. As a Business Analyst, you will be responsible for analyzing data, understanding user requirements, and collaborating with various teams to drive strategic initiatives. This position is essential in ensuring that DISH remains competitive in a rapidly evolving telecommunications landscape, influencing key decisions that affect products, services, and customer satisfaction.
In this role, you will engage with cross-functional teams, such as engineering and product management, to develop insights that guide product development and operations. Your analytical skills will be crucial in identifying trends and opportunities that enhance user experiences and streamline processes. The complexity of projects at DISH, including innovative service offerings and data-driven decision-making, makes this position both challenging and rewarding, allowing you to have a significant impact on the business.

Preparation for your interview as a Business Analyst at DISH involves understanding the key evaluation criteria that interviewers will focus on. Be ready to demonstrate your strengths in the following areas:
Role-related knowledge – This criterion assesses your understanding of data analysis tools and methodologies. Interviewers will evaluate your familiarity with relevant technologies and your ability to apply them in practical scenarios.
Problem-solving ability – You will be tested on how you approach complex challenges. Showcase your ability to analyze situations critically and propose data-driven solutions.
Leadership – In this role, influencing and collaborating with cross-functional teams is crucial. Demonstrate your communication skills and how you mobilize others towards common goals.
Culture fit / values – DISH values alignment is essential. Be prepared to discuss how your experiences and values align with those of the company.
Interview Process Overview
The interview process for the Business Analyst position at DISH is designed to be thorough and engaging. It typically begins with a phone screening by a recruiter, followed by a series of assessments that may include cognitive tests focusing on analytical reasoning and problem-solving. Successful candidates will then progress to in-person interviews with team members, the hiring manager, and possibly higher management.
The process emphasizes not just technical skills but also cultural fit and communication abilities. Expect a structured progression, with each stage assessing different aspects of your candidacy. DISH values a collaborative approach, so showcasing your ability to work well with teams will be critical.
